Pressure Laundering Timber Surfaces
When stress washing wood surface areas, it's vital to pick the right devices and method to prevent damages. Begin by choosing a pressure washer with flexible setups. A lower stress, generally in between 1,200 to 1,500 PSI, is suitable for timber. This helps stop gouging or stripping the wood fibers.
Before you start, make sure to get rid of the area of furniture, plants, and other challenges. It's essential to examine a tiny, unnoticeable section first to ensure your technique and stress settings will not hurt the surface.
Make use of a fan nozzle add-on for an even distribution of water. Hold the nozzle at a 45-degree angle and at the very least 12 inches far from the timber to lessen the threat of damage.
As you wash, move in long, sweeping motions along the grain of the timber. This strategy helps lift dust and particles efficiently without leaving streaks.
After cleaning, wash the surface completely to eliminate any continuing to be cleaning solution. Enable the timber to completely dry totally prior to using any kind of sealant or tarnish. Following these actions will guarantee your timber surfaces continue to be in fantastic problem while looking fresh and tidy.
Methods for Cleansing Concrete
Concrete surface areas can accumulate dust, crud, and discolorations over time, making effective cleaning techniques crucial. To begin, you'll want to use a stress washing machine with a minimum of 3000 PSI for concrete cleansing. This degree of pressure successfully removes persistent discolorations without harming the surface area.
Before you begin, spray the area with a concrete cleaner or a mix of detergent and water. Enable it to dwell for about 10-15 minutes; this assists break down hard spots.
Next off, affix a wide spray nozzle to your stress washing machine, ideally a 25-degree or 40-degree suggestion. This will certainly distribute the water uniformly and reduce the threat of etching.
When you start stress washing, work in areas. Maintain the nozzle regarding 12 inches from the surface area and maintain a steady, sweeping activity. This method guarantees you do not miss any places or use excessive stress in one location.
For especially stubborn spots, you may need to repeat the process or utilize an extra focused cleaner.
Finally, wash the location extensively after cleansing. This step prevents any type of residue from staying on the concrete, leaving it clean and looking fresh.
Best Practices for Vinyl Exterior Siding
Vinyl exterior siding is a prominent selection for homeowners due to its toughness and low maintenance needs. However, to maintain it looking its ideal, you'll need to press laundry it periodically.
Begin by preparing the location-- eliminate any furniture, plants, or obstacles near your home. Next off, pick a stress washing machine with a nozzle that supplies a vast spray; generally, a 25-degree nozzle functions well.
Prior to you start, check a small section to ensure your setups won't damage the house siding. Maintain the pressure listed below 2000 PSI to prevent any damages or fractures. Start from the bottom and work your means up, washing in sections to avoid touches.
Make use of a detergent specifically formulated for vinyl exterior siding to aid get rid of dust and mold. Use it with your pressure washer or a pump sprayer, permitting it to sit for around 10 mins.
Later, rinse thoroughly from the top down, ensuring all detergent is eliminated. Lastly, evaluate the exterior siding for any type of missed spots or persistent stains that might need extra interest.
